Image is a screenshot of a Cult Mtl article (https://cultmtl.com/2025/10/mark-carney-seen-as-calm-and-rational-pierre-poilievre-as-arrogant-and-hot-tempered/). 
It reads:

A new study by Spark Insights has examined Canadians’ views on the traits associated with Prime Minister Mark Carney and Conservative Party leader Pierre Poilievre.

When compared to Poilievre, Mark Carney is seen as more calm and rational (+24), as well as more thoughtful and strategic (+19). He’s a leader with useful experience (+28), who understands the economy (+18) and can make tough decisions (+12).

Pierre Poilievre, on the other hand, is more closely associated with arrogance (+18) and hot-temperedness (+20).

Image is a screenshot from the Elections Canada website  (https://www.elections.ca/content.aspx?section=vot&dir=reg/svr&document=index&lang=e). 
It reads:
Deadline to apply to vote by mail in the current by-election
Elections Canada must receive your completed application by the deadline indicated below.

If you apply online or to Elections Canada in Ottawa: Tuesday, April 7, 2026 at 6 p.m. Eastern time.
If you apply to a local Elections Canada office: Tuesday, April 7, 2026 at 6 p.m. local time.
